>> On 3 Oct 2015, at 11:28 am, bill lam <[email protected]> wrote:
>>
>> $$ looks like a scalar but is a rank 1 array. use #$ instead.
>> ,:`]@.(<:@#@$) fee=:'ab'
>>
>> the verb
>> ,:`]@.(<:@$^:2 fee) is reduced to ] and then run as ] fee

>>> I have a variable, fee, which might have shape
>>> N,2 or just 2. I want a function that converts
>>> fee when it has shape 2 to shape 1 2.
>>>
>>> It seems straightforward: if the rank is 2,
>>> make no change, if 1, apply ,:
>>>
>>> So something like ,:`]@.(<:@$^:2) should
>>> do the trick. Indeed, this works:
>>>
>>> $ ,:`]@.(<:@$^:2 fee) fee=:'ab'
>>> 1 3
>>>
>>> But when I try to define something to do
>>> what I want, I get lost.
>>>
>>> ,:`]@.(<:@$^:2) fee=:'ab'
>>> |rank error
>>> | ,:`]@.(<:@$^:2)fee=:'ab'
>>> ,:`]@.(<:@$^:2 ]) fee=:'ab'
>>> |domain error
>>> | ,:`]@.(<:@$^:2]) fee=:'ab'
>>> ,:`]@.((<:@$^:2)@: ]) fee=:'ab'
>>> |rank error
>>> | ,:`]@.((<:@$^:2)@:]) fee=:'ab'
>>>
>>>
>>>
>>> (I'll spare you more)
>>>
>>> I must be missing something obvious.
